Unlike most combi boilers, the Rinnai i090CN contains a proportional valve which allows for simultaneous delivery of domestic hot water and central heating without interruption of the heating flow.
The I- Series Rinnai i090CN model includes a self-cleaning stainless-steel heat exchanger. This means that homeowners need to perform a flush (way to clean a tankless) of their systems less often than conventional heat exchangers require. The Rinnai i090CN provides an input rating of 90K Btu for the furnace side of things and 160K Btu for domestic hot water heating. Rinnai’s i090CN combi system can be fueled with either Natural Gas or Propane and is capable of using both fuels out of the box. Rinnai’s condensing gas boiler has obtained one of the highest AFUEs (energy efficiency) in the industry. Plus, the compact wall-mounted design saves space over traditional boilers.

Rinnai i090CN Specifications
Item | Spec |
---|---|
Model Number | i090CN |
Fuel | Convertible |
Product Weight | 73.0 lb / (33 kg) |
AFUE Rating | 95.9% |
Turn Down Ratio | 6.0:1 |
Min Input – Heating/Hot Water | 15,000 BTU / (4.3 kW) |
Max Input – Heating | 90,000 BTU / (26.4 kW) |
Max Input – Hot Water | 160,000 BTU / (46.9 kW) |
Hot Water Flow @ 70°F Rise | 4.1 GPM / (15.5 l/min) |
Maximum Electrical Use | CH: 158 watts DHW: 174 watts |
Standby Electrical | 4 watts |
Boiler Pump | Fixed Speed |
